Job Description

(Physician/MD qualifications required)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ation - Acute inpatient rehabilitation presents a unique opportunity to collaborate closely with another physiatrist while maintaining independence and control over your practice. Each physician operates within their designated hospital, supported by a skilled nurse practitioner (NP), fostering a cohesive yet autonomous environment. Sharing on-call duties allows for greater flexibility and ensures that patient care remains a top priority. This rewarding role is centered in a modern 25-bed rehab unit located in Sanford, FL, where you have the chance to impact patients' lives positively. Should the need arise, an NP can be integrated into your practice, with their compensation directly drawn from the doctors' collections, enhancing your earning potential. Financially, this position is highly lucrative, with annual earnings projected between $300,000 to $350,000 when working alongside an NP, complemented by a medical director stipend ranging from $80,000 to $100,000. You can choose between a 1099 arrangement—which allows for greater autonomy but requires personal management of medical malpractice insurance—or a W2 structure, providing additional stability. Importantly, all billing operations will be streamlined through the organization, allowing you to focus on what you do best: delivering exceptional care to your patients.
